#4c3708 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c3708 is composed of 29.8% red, 21.6%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.6% magenta, 89.5%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 41.5 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 16.5%. #4c3708 color hex could be obtained by blending #986e10 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#4c3708

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050401 is the darkest color, while #fefaf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c3708

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2b28 is the less saturated color, while #523902 is the most saturated one.
